Table 2.
Descriptive analysis of participants’ HIV testing habits and self-testing experience in China in 2020.
Variables | Values, n (%) | |
How often do you test for HIV? (N=692) | ||
|
3 months | 398 (57.5) |
|
6 months | 140 (20.2) |
|
1 year or more | 154 (22.3) |
Number of times tested for HIV last year (N=692) | ||
|
Never | 80 (11.6) |
|
Once | 117 (16.9) |
|
≥Twice | 495 (71.5) |
Know your HIV status (N=692) | ||
|
Yes | 642 (92.8) |
|
No | 50 (7.2) |
Ever self-tested for HIV (N=692) | ||
|
Yes | 456 (65.9) |
|
No | 156 (22.5) |
|
Never heard of self-testing | 80 (11.6) |
Used HIV self-testing kit for first HIV test | ||
|
Yes (n=456) | 194 (42.5) |
|
No (n=456) | 262 (57.5) |
Ever considered testing for HIV at home prior to a sexual encounter (N=692) | ||
|
Yes | 560 (80.9) |
|
No | 132 (19.1) |
Concerns when you use HIV self-testing (N=692) | ||
|
Is it working correctly? | 237 (34.2) |
|
Time to wait for results to appear | 204 (29.5) |
|
Results accuracy | 201 (29) |
|
Read the results correctly | 276 (39.9) |
Comfortable sharing a picture of HIVST results with health worker for reporting (N=692) | ||
|
Yes | 347 (50.1) |
|
No | 345 (49.9) |
